Private Transfers: The Pinnacle of Speed and Convenience
When speed and door-to-door service are your top priorities, a private transfer stands out as the premier choice. This service typically involves a pre-booked vehicle, often a car or a minivan, that will pick you up directly from your accommodation in Girona city and transport you to the airport terminal. The journey is remarkably swift, typically taking around 15 minutes, depending on traffic conditions within the city. The cost for this convenience can range from approximately €30 to €110, a price that reflects the directness and personalized nature of the service. This option is particularly attractive for families, groups, or individuals who value comfort and wish to avoid any potential hassle associated with public transport.
Booking a private transfer in advance is highly recommended, especially during peak travel seasons. This ensures availability and often allows you to secure a better price. Many reputable companies operate in the Girona region, and online comparisons can help you find the best deal. The advantage here is predictability; you know exactly how you're getting to the airport and when, eliminating any last-minute uncertainties.
The Direct Bus Service: An Economical and Reliable Option
For travellers looking for a more budget-friendly solution, the direct bus service between Girona city and Girona Airport is an excellent and widely used option. This service offers a cost-effective way to reach your destination without compromising on reliability. Buses depart from the main bus station in Girona, known as Girona, Estació d'Autobusos, and make a direct journey to the Girona Airport terminal. The frequency of these services is generally good, with departures typically occurring on an hourly basis. This means you're unlikely to have a long wait for the next bus.
The bus journey, while slightly longer than a private transfer due to potential stops and city navigation, is still relatively short, usually taking around 25-30 minutes. The exact timings can vary, so it's always wise to check the latest schedule. The pricing for the bus is significantly lower than private transfers, making it a popular choice for solo travellers, backpackers, and those conscious of their spending.

Taxis: Flexibility and Availability
Traditional taxis are another viable option for getting from Girona to Girona Airport. Taxis offer a good balance of convenience and flexibility. You can usually find them readily available at taxi ranks throughout the city, or you can book one by phone or through a taxi app. Like private transfers, taxis provide a direct, door-to-door service. The journey time is comparable to private transfers, typically around 15-20 minutes, depending on traffic.
The cost of a taxi from Girona city to the airport will vary depending on the meter, the time of day (there may be surcharges for late-night travel), and the specific taxi company. It's advisable to ask for an estimated fare before starting your journey if possible, or to ensure the meter is running. While generally more expensive than the bus, taxis can sometimes be competitive with private transfers, especially for shorter distances or if you're travelling during off-peak hours. They offer the advantage of being able to hail one spontaneously if you haven't pre-booked another service.
Comparing Your Options: A Quick Overview
To help you make an informed decision, here's a comparative look at the main transport methods:
| Transport Method | Estimated Journey Time | Estimated Cost (€) | Key Features |
|---|---|---|---|
| Private Transfer | 15 minutes | 30 - 110 | Fastest, door-to-door, pre-booked, convenient |
| Direct Bus | 25-30 minutes | Lower (check current fares) | Economical, frequent, direct from bus station |
| Taxi | 15-20 minutes | Variable (metered) | Flexible, readily available, door-to-door |
Note: Costs are approximate and can vary based on time, traffic, and specific provider.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the absolute fastest way to get from Girona to Girona Airport?
A1: The fastest way is by private transfer or a taxi, both typically taking around 15 minutes.
Q2: Is the bus service reliable for airport travel?
A2: Yes, the direct bus service is generally very reliable, operating hourly throughout the day, every day. It's a popular and dependable option.
Q3: Can I buy bus tickets in advance?
A3: Bus tickets can usually be purchased directly from the driver or at the Girona bus station. It's advisable to check with the specific bus operator for their ticketing policies.
Q4: What if my flight is very early in the morning?
A4: For very early flights, a pre-booked private transfer or taxi is the most reliable option, as they operate 24/7 and can pick you up at your specified time. Bus services may have limited hours for very early departures, so always check the schedule.
Q5: How much luggage can I bring on the bus?
A5: Typically, standard luggage allowances apply on buses. You can usually store suitcases in the luggage compartment underneath the bus. If you have excessive or oversized luggage, a private transfer or taxi might be more suitable.
